The Cease and Desist Letter for Defamation provides a formal request for the cessation of false and misleading statements that harm an individual's reputation, particularly through social media channels without consent in Tarrant. This form serves as an essential tool for individuals to address potential defamation, either slander or libel, by directly notifying the offending party of the consequences of their actions. Key features of the form include sections for detailing the specific false statements, mailing addresses, and a signature line for legal validation. Filling instructions emphasize the need for clarity when describing the defamatory statements and provide space for the sender's personal information.
